Quote:
Originally Posted by Blueface View Post
I thought with iTunes you had to take the ringtone as they have it set.
Can you mess with the song to cut it up any way you want?
Also, with Garage Band, it is free if you use a song from your library.
I am sure with iTunes you have to pay for it.
Incorrect, sir.

With iTunes, you can take a non-DRM track (an AAC or MP3 that doesn't have protection on it), cut it up, and re-import it as a ringtone. Quick. Free. Easy.

And it works with both Macs and Windoze.
